Titanium EFW Pipes are generally made from commercially pure grades such as Grade 2 (UNS R50400) or alloyed grades like Grade 5 (Ti-6Al-4V). These pipes showcase high tensile strength (345–895 MPa), yield strength (275–830 MPa), and elongation of 20–30%, depending on the specific grade. Their makeup includes Titanium (≥ 99.2%), along with trace elements like Iron, Oxygen, and Aluminum. With a low density (4.5 g/cm³), a high melting point (~1668°C), and excellent fatigue resistance, Titanium is perfect for use in extreme environments, including those that are corrosive, high-pressure, or sensitive to temperature changes.

Grade | Ti | C | Fe | H | N | O | Al | V |
Titanium Gr 2 | 99.2 min | 0.1 max | 0.3 max | 0.015 max | 0.03 max | 0.25 max | – | – |
Titanium Gr 5 | 90 min | – | 0.25 max | – | – | 0.2 max | 6 min | 4 min |
Grade | Density | Melting Point | Tensile Strength | Yield Strength (0.2%Offset) | Elongation |
Ti Gr 2 | 4.5 g/cm3 | 1665 °C (3030 °F) | Psi – 49900 , MPa – 344 | Psi – 39900 , MPa – 275 | 20 % |
Ti Gr 5 | 4.43 g/cm3 | 1632 °C (2970 °F) | Psi – 138000 , MPa – 950 | Psi – 128000 , MPa – 880 | 14 % |

Titanium EFW Pipes find extensive use in industries that demand exceptional corrosion resistance, lightweight strength, and long-lasting durability. In the chemical and petrochemical fields, these pipes manage aggressive acids, chlorides, and high-temperature steam. In marine engineering, they stand up to seawater corrosion and biofouling. The aerospace sector utilizes them for hydraulic systems and structural tubing, thanks to their superior strength-to-weight ratio. In desalination plants and power generation, titanium pipes are preferred for heat exchangers and other critical applications, ensuring efficiency and reliability in challenging conditions.
